Destroy the Abu Sayaf tells Duterte to troops




President Rodrigo Duterte has ordered the military to “destroy” the Abu Sayyaf group following the deadly blasts at a Roman Catholic cathedral in Jolo, Sulu on Sunday which left 21 people dead.
Duterte visited Jolo on Monday to inspect the bombed Our Lady of Mt. Carmel Cathedral and met with the relatives of the victims where he provided them financial assistance and vowed to give justice to their loved ones.
The President then spoke to an audience that included soldiers as he directed them to crush the Abu Sayyaf by “whatever means.”
“I’m ordering you now: Pulpugin ninyo ang Abu Sayyaf by whatever means,” the President said in his speech, a transcript of which was released by Malacañang on Tuesday.
“Meron man tayong helicopter, may eroplano, may mga barko. Eh iyong mga bala natin diyan sa mga kanyon ninyo...paputukin na ninyo. I-bomba muna ninyo lahat, magbili na tayo ng bagong stock.”
The President made it clea
r that civilians must be spared from the military offensive against the group notorious for kidnapping and bombing operations.
advertisement
“Ang gawin ninyo sabihin ninyo pagka-bobombahin mo ‘yang lahat, paalisin mo iyong mga tao. Paalisin mo ‘yung mga tao, ilagay mo dito kung saan ako ang maggastos ng pagkain, lahat. Tapos plantsahin ninyo ng bala...,” he said.
“Kunin ko ‘yung lahat ng inosenteng tao. Halikayo dito, ako ang magpakain muna. Magsakripisyo ako. Hanap ako pera. Tapos pulpugin mo ‘yang teritoryo nila.”
Authorities said that an Abu Sayyaf subgroup, the Ajang-Ajang group, was likely behind the Jolo attacks, which killed 21 people and injured some 100 others, even as terror group Islamic State has already claimed responsibility.
lockdown has been imposed following the attacks to ensure security and chase the perpetrators of the bombings, the first inside the cathedral and was followed by a second blast outside, which was detonated as security forces raced to the scene.
Security had also been tightened across the Sulu province.
“Our duty is to protect the Filipino people; and second is that we have to preserve the nation,” Duterte said.

A woman was arrested in a buy-bust in Ormoc City

A woman was arrested in a buy-bust along Zone 3, Malbasag Dist. 28 about 1:45 a.m. Friday (Feb. 1). City Drug Enforcement Unit chief P/SInsp. Romeo Franklyn Parangan identified the suspect as Mae Quintana, 30, a mother of two and residing in Barugo, Leyte. Parangan said Quintana is the live-in partner of April Jan Arevalo, who was arrested last October in a buy-bust operation in the same area. Police tagged Arevalo, a drug surrenderee, as a high-value target. Recovered from Quintana was one small sachet containing suspected shabu procured by a poseur-buyer operative at P1000, and two P500 cash used as marked money for the operation. Also seized was a sachet that contains five small plastic sachets containing suspected shabu each worth about P500. Quintana did not say anything when asked about the shabu in her possession.
